This study aims to determine the magnitude of the relationship between principal transformational leadership style variables, communication style, work ethic, and work motivation on teacher performance at SMK Negeri 2 Tejakula. This type of research is ex post facto with multiple linear regression analysis designs. The population in this study was 50 people. The research sample of this research was 44 people. Collecting data using a questionnaire about the principal's transformational leadership style, communication style, work ethic, and work motivation on teacher performance. The collected data were analyzed using correlation analysis techniques, multiple regression, and partial correlation. The results showed that (1) there is a relationship between the principal's transformational leadership style and teacher performance at 57.7%, (2) there is a relationship between communication style and teacher performance at 71.0%, (3) there is a relationship between work ethic and teacher performance by 75.5%, (4) there is a relationship between work motivation and teacher performance by 49.7%, and (5) there is a relationship between the school principal's transformational leadership style, communication style, work ethic and work motivation which are significantly correlated with performance teachers with a correlation of 85.2%.
